Gimme Friction: Television at Shepherd’s Bush Empire, London
Barney Hoskyns, Rock's Backpages, 21 April 2001
ONE MOMENT, more than any other during this one-off London show on Easter Sunday, summed up the nature of the curious rock beast that is Television. As bassist Fred Smith – anchorman and peacekeeper in the quartets volatile mix of egos – introduced TVs two principal sparring partners, both men were entirely invisible to anyone who wasnt standing at the very lip of the stage.
